What is Technology Integration and Why Does it Matter?
Technology integration essentially refers to the thoughtful and purposeful use of technology tools to enhance learning within a classroom setting. It's not just about replacing traditional methods with fancy gadgets, but rather about strategically incorporating technology to make learning more engaging, effective, and accessible for all students.
The Importance of Tech Integration in the Classroom
Boosts Engagement and Motivation:
Interactive tools, simulations, and digital games can make learning more fun and capture students' attention.
Technology allows for a wider variety of learning activities, catering to different learning styles and preferences.
Enhances Collaboration and Communication:
Online platforms facilitate collaboration on projects, group discussions, and peer review.
Students can connect with classmates and experts from around the world, fostering a global learning environment.
Supports Personalized Learning:
Technology allows teachers to tailor instruction to individual needs.
Adaptive learning tools can adjust the difficulty level based on student performance, and online resources cater to diverse learning styles.
Deepens Understanding and Critical Thinking:
Simulations and data visualization tools can help students explore complex concepts in an interactive way.
Technology can be used to encourage research, analysis, and problem-solving skills.
Improves Access to Information and Resources:
The internet provides access to a vast amount of information, multimedia resources, and educational tools.
Students can conduct research, explore diverse perspectives, and develop information literacy skills.
Prepares Students for the Future:
Technology is an integral part of our world, and integrating it into the classroom equips students with the digital literacy skills needed for success in college and careers.
They learn essential skills like communication, collaboration, and critical thinking in a technology-rich environment.

The educational technology landscape is vast and ever-evolving, offering a plethora of tools to enhance your classroom instruction. Here's a dive into some key categories to spark your exploration:
1. Presentation Tools:
Traditional Tools: Revamp classic presentations with interactive features. Consider using Microsoft PowerPoint or Google Slides to embed polls, quizzes, and collaborative activities within your slides.
Web-Based Whiteboards: Tools like Padlet, Miro, or Mural create a virtual whiteboard space where students can brainstorm, collaborate visually, and organize information in real-time.
Presentation Software with Audience Engagement: Platforms like Mentimeter or Pear Deck allow for live audience participation through polls, quizzes, and word clouds, keeping students actively involved.
2. Online Resources:
Curated Content Platforms: Websites like Khan Academy, TED-Ed, and National Geographic Education offer high-quality video lessons, simulations, and interactive exercises across various subjects.
Open Educational Resources (OERs): Discover a treasure trove of free, openly-licensed educational materials like textbooks, articles, and multimedia resources at OER repositories like OER Commons or MERLOT.
Educational News Sites: Stay updated on current events and integrate them into your curriculum with resources from sites like Newsela or Education Week, which offer age-appropriate news articles.
3. Digital Content Creation Tools:
Video Creation Tools: Tools like iMovie (Apple) or WeVideo allow students to create engaging video presentations, documentaries, or explainer videos to showcase their learning.
Infographic Creation Tools: Platforms like Canva or Piktochart empower students to transform complex information into visually appealing infographics, enhancing their communication skills.
Coding and Programming Tools: Scratch by MIT and Blockly are user-friendly coding platforms that introduce students to the fundamentals of computer science in a fun and interactive way.
4. Collaborative Platforms:
Project Management Tools: Platforms like Trello or Asana help students organize tasks, collaborate on group projects, and track progress efficiently.
Cloud Storage and Collaboration: Google Drive or Microsoft OneDrive provide secure cloud storage for students to share documents, presentations, and other files seamlessly.
Online Discussion Forums: Platforms like Edmodo or Schoology create online communities where students can discuss topics, share resources, and collaborate on assignments beyond the classroom walls.
5. Assessment Tools:
Online Quizzes and Tests: Platforms like Kahoot!, Quizizz, or Google Forms allow for interactive quizzes, surveys, and assessments that provide immediate feedback for students and teachers.
Exit Tickets and Quick Checks: Tools like Mentimeter or Plickers offer quick and easy ways to gauge student understanding at the end of a lesson or activity.
Student Portfolios and E-Journals: Platforms like Seesaw or Google Sites allow students to create online portfolios where they can showcase their work, reflections, and progress over time.

Technology can be a powerful asset in your classroom, but it's important to choose the right tools for the specific learning objectives you want to achieve. Here's a framework to guide your decision-making process:
1. Identify Your Learning Objectives:
What key knowledge, skills, or understanding do you want students to gain from the lesson or unit?
Are you focusing on content acquisition, critical thinking, communication, collaboration, or a combination of these?
2. Analyze the Learning Activities:
What activities will students engage in to achieve the learning objectives?
Will they be conducting research, creating presentations, participating in discussions, or solving problems?
3. Consider Technology's Role:
How can technology enhance or support the planned learning activities?
Can it make the activities more engaging, interactive, or efficient?
4. Matching Tech Tools to Objectives and Activities:
Here are some examples to illustrate this process:
Learning Objective: Students will analyze primary source documents from the American Revolution.
Learning Activity: Students will work in groups to research and analyze different documents, then present their findings to the class.
Possible Technology Tools:
Online document repository: Access primary sources online (Library of Congress website)
Collaborative workspace: Annotate documents and share findings in real-time (Padlet, Google Docs)
Presentation software with audience engagement: Create interactive presentations and polls to assess student understanding (Mentimeter, Pear Deck)
Learning Objective: Students will learn about the life cycle of a butterfly.
Learning Activity: Students will create a multimedia presentation on the butterfly life cycle.
Possible Technology Tools:
Video creation tools: Students film a short documentary on the butterfly life cycle (iMovie, WeVideo)
Image editing tools: Edit photos and create visuals for the presentation (Canva)
Presentation software: Showcase their learning through an engaging presentation (Microsoft PowerPoint, Google Slides)
5. Additional Considerations:
Student Age and Ability Level: Choose tools that are age-appropriate and accessible for your students' technical skills.
Time Constraints: Consider the time needed for students to learn and use the technology tool effectively within the lesson timeframe.
School Resources: Ensure the chosen technology is compatible with your school's existing technology infrastructure and internet access.
By following this framework, you can make informed decisions about integrating technology into your classroom. Remember, the goal is to use technology as a tool to empower student learning, not as the sole focus of the lesson.

Draft 3
Technology integration shouldn't be an afterthought; it should be thoughtfully woven into the fabric of your curriculum, aligning with learning standards and instructional strategies. Here's how to achieve a cohesive approach:
1. Start with the Learning Standards:
Identify the specific learning standards or objectives your students are working towards in a particular unit or lesson.
Analyze the skills and knowledge outlined in the standards.
2. Consider Instructional Strategies:
What teaching methods will you use to help students achieve those standards?
Will you employ lectures, group discussions, project-based learning, or a combination of approaches?
3. Find the Tech Fit:
How can technology enhance or support your chosen instructional strategies?
Can technology tools make learning more interactive, engaging, or personalized for students?
Here are some examples of effective technology integration aligned with curriculum and instruction:
Subject: Science (Topic: Photosynthesis)
Learning Standard: Students will be able to explain the process of photosynthesis and its role in plant life.
Instructional Strategy: Interactive Simulation
Technology Tool: Online interactive simulation that allows students to manipulate variables and observe the impact on photosynthesis (e.g., PhET Interactive Simulations)
Subject: History (Topic: The American Civil War)
Learning Standard: Students will be able to analyze primary sources to understand different perspectives on the Civil War.
Instructional Strategy: Document Analysis with Collaboration Tools
Technology Tool: Online repository of primary sources (Library of Congress) combined with a collaborative workspace where students can annotate documents and share findings (Padlet, Google Docs)
Strategies for Seamless Integration:
SAMR Model: Use the SAMR model (Substitute, Augment, Modify, Redefine) to guide your technology integration.
Substitute: Start by using technology as a basic replacement for traditional tools (e.g., online quizzes instead of paper quizzes).
Augment: Gradually move towards using technology to enhance existing activities (e.g., interactive presentations instead of static slides).
Modify: Transform activities with technology to create new and engaging learning experiences (e.g., student-created documentaries instead of textbook readings).
Redefine: Utilize technology to create entirely new learning opportunities that wouldn't be possible without it (e.g., virtual field trips, global collaborations).
Focus on Differentiation: Technology can be a powerful tool to differentiate instruction and cater to diverse learning styles. Use online resources, adaptive learning tools, or project-based learning activities to meet the individual needs of your students.
Assessment and Feedback: Integrate technology tools for formative and summative assessment. Utilize online quizzes, discussion forums, or student portfolio platforms to track progress and provide timely feedback.
Remember: Technology is a tool, not a replacement for effective teaching. The key is to use it strategically to support your curriculum, enhance student learning, and create a dynamic and engaging classroom environment.
